Tritoma season is Spring and Summer and Peppertree season is Spring and Summer. The type of soil for Tritoma is Clay, Loam, Sand and for Peppertree is Loam, Sand while the PH of soil for Tritoma is Acidic, Neutral and for Peppertree is Acidic, Neutral, Alkaline.
Tritoma and Peppertree Physical Information
Tritoma and Peppertree physical information is very important for comparison. Tritoma height is 45.70 cm and width 50.80 cm whereas Peppertree height is 1,219.20 cm and width 1,219.20 cm. The color specification of Tritoma and Peppertree are as follows:
Tritoma flower color: Yellow, Red, Orange and Pink
Tritoma leaf color: Green and Blue Green
Peppertree flower color: Light Yellow
- Peppertree leaf color: Green
Care of Tritoma and Peppertree
Care of Tritoma and Peppertree include pruning, fertilizers, watering etc. Tritoma pruning is done Cut or pinch the stems, Remove damaged leaves, Remove dead branches and Remove dead leaves and Peppertree pruning is done Cut limbs, Remove damaged leaves, Remove dead branches, Remove dead leaves and Remove dead or diseased plant parts. In summer Tritoma needs Lots of watering and in winter, it needs Average Water. Whereas, in summer Peppertree needs Lots of watering and in winter, it needs Average Water.
